Why is Chetan Bhagat Famous?
Chetan Bhagat rose to fame with his debut novel, Five Point Someone, which became an instant hit among readers. His ability to connect with the youth through relatable characters and contemporary themes struck a chord with millions of readers.
Bhagat’s subsequent novels, such as One Night @ the Call Center, 2 States, and Half Girlfriend, further solidified his position as one of the most popular authors in India. His books have been adapted into successful Bollywood films, further amplifying his fame and recognition.
Chetan Bhagat Biography Overview
Early Life
Chetan Bhagat was born on April 22, 1974, in New Delhi, India. His father, Chaman Talwar, was an army officer. Bhagat’s early years were spent in several cities due to his father’s postings, which allowed him to experience a diverse range of cultures and people. This exposure influenced his writing style, enabling him to weave diverse characters and settings into his stories.
Education
Bhagat pursued his education at the prestigious Indian Institute of Technology (IIT) Delhi, where he earned a degree in mechanical engineering. He later went on to pursue a postgraduate degree in business administration from the Indian Institute of Management (IIM) Ahmedabad.
Despite his academic inclinations, Bhagat harbored a passion for writing from an early age, which eventually led him to pursue a career in storytelling.
Career and Awards
Chetan Bhagat’s literary career took off with the publication of his first novel, Five Point Someone, in 2004. The book received widespread acclaim and was later adapted into the successful film 3 Idiots. This marked the beginning of Bhagat’s journey as a bestselling author.
Over the years, Bhagat has penned several other popular novels, including The 3 Mistakes of My Life, Revolution 2020, Half Girlfriend, and One Indian Girl. His books have consistently topped the bestseller lists in India and have been translated into multiple languages.
In recognition of his contribution to the field of literature, Bhagat has received various awards and honors. These include the Society Young Achiever’s Award, Publisher’s Recognition Award, and the CNN-IBN Indian of the Year award in the Entertainment category.
